    Bosch SGS 43EO2/GB/45 FD 8401.

    He complained it was not finishing cycle?

    Reset, start, drain pump comes on and runs, water valve opens then drain pump cuts in, just keeps filling and draining at the same time.

    So Far, No water in base of appliance, the pressure switch for the circ pump is mounted by the metering tank,the plenum chamber for the switch is clear, the overfill float is clean and the micro switch checks out, the rod down to the float in the base is fine and not sticking.

    At the top l/h side of the metering tank there appears to be a black slime build up, this is in the area of the air break between the pump outlet and the pump supply pipe, I have removed the tank and i am in the process of cleaning it.

    Hose to sump is clear, I am pretty sure there is no turbine counter on the water inlet but have not delved deeper at the mo.

    if you cancel the programme does the pump turn off in the end or keep running

    if it keep running suspect faulty triac in the timer
